ihaveamac wrote:

Use google if you don't know what something means.

I ran AV Defender 2011 on my computer not in a virtual machine, not sand-boxed, I just ran it. It's an aggressive rogue antivirus that REALLY blocks program access (except iexplore.exe), and sets itself as the windows shell. The shell is explorer.exe, this thing sets itself as it so it starts in even safe mode.

I dared myself to do it. And I made it out alive. xP I killed the process by renaming taskmgr to iexplore, reset the shell, and then 0wned AV Defender with a real anti-malware program.
